02 Purpose and work
What the charity exists to do
The trust was constututed by Will of the Late Alexander Moncur which states - 'Save only as regards administrative charges and costs, the free annual income of Alexander Moncur’s Trust, and even the capital thereof to such extent as the Trustees shall in their sole and absolute discretion think fit, shall be applied annually or otherwise by the Trustees solely and exclusively to charitable purposes in Scotland and England, the Trustees being the sole judges of the particular charitable purposes aforesaid to be benefited from time to time' The Trust did not undertake any activity directly but meets its charitable purposes by making grants to Uk Charities active in Dundee and the surrounding area
